Different types of business travel accommodation options

1. Hotels

Hotels are a popular choice amongst business travelers due to their convenience of booking and excellent availability. Travelers can choose from luxury 5 and 4-star hotels to economical 3-star and budget hotels. Different types of hotels offer distinct services and amenities. Some of these amenities include room services, housekeeping, a gym, a spa, recreational centers, swimming pools, etc.

Special features

  • Convenience, amenities, and services make hotels a popular choice
  • Wide range of room types, from standard rooms to suites
  • Services like room service, business centers, meeting rooms, and on-site dining options

2. Service apartments

Serviced apartments are good business travel lodging options for travelers who want to get a homely feeling and privacy while staying away from home. These apartments are fully furnished with luxury facilities such as air-conditioners, refrigerators, kitchenettes, living spaces, comfortable beds, laundry facilities, and much more. These kinds of apartments provide hotel-like services in a more relaxed environment.

Special features

  • Fully furnished apartments with a homely feel
  • Equipped with amenities like kitchenettes or full kitchens, separate living and sleeping areas, and laundry facilities
  • Suitable for longer business stays or those who prefer a residential experience

3. Extended stay hotels

As the name suggests, these business trip accommodation are specially designed to cater to the long-stay requirements of travelers. The hotels are equipped with comforting amenities and wholesome facilities. The hotels have large rooms usually with separate work areas. Further, as the accommodation is booked for an extended period of time, the rooms are available at discounted rates.

Special features

  • Hotels specifically cater to long-term stays
  • Larger rooms or suites with additional amenities like kitchenettes, laundry facilities, and work areas
  • Designed to provide a comfortable and home-like environment for extended assignments

4. Corporate housing

Corporate housing refers to fully furnished guest houses that are arranged by corporate enterprises for temporary lodging solutions. This is a distinct type of stay provided by the corporates during the relocation of a new employee or transferring an old one to a new location. These are best for employees who are not aware of the city or location and have to search for a house while still carrying out the day-to-day responsibility of their job.

Special features

  • Fully furnished apartments or houses rented temporarily
  • Often arranged by companies for employees during business travel or relocations
  • Offers more space and privacy compared to traditional hotel rooms, ideal for longer stays

5. Farmhouse near the airport

Offsite farmhouses are easy to get and offer world-class amenities at affordable prices. These kinds of facilities can be used for group travelers or team-building exercises. Some of the farmhouses come with large lawns, swimming pools, equipped halls, home theaters, and more. Further, corporates can use workspaces provided in the farmhouse for a short stay away from offices in a new location.

Special features

  • Accommodations are offered through platforms like Paxes, including private rooms, apartments, and farmhouses
  • Provides flexibility and often more affordable options, particularly for extended stays
  • Suitability for remote business needs, such as reliable Wi-Fi and a suitable workspace

6. Boutique hotels

Boutique hotels are small and independent hotels, focusing on customized and unique living experiences. The hotels maintain distinct decor to differentiate themselves from various hotel chains. They are perfect for people looking to experience more personalized service with a mix of cultural flavors. They can be found in busy localities with generally medium to high tariffs.

Special features

  • Smaller, independent hotels focusing on personalized service and unique experiences
  • Stylish and themed rooms, intimate settings, and specialized amenities
  • Ideal for business travelers seeking an intimate and upscale environment

7. Co-living spaces

A Community driven accommodation or co-living space is best for short stays. One should understand that the co-living spaces offer several room types with single, double, and so on occupancy types. Therefore privacy can be a major issue with these hotels. However, these hotels serve the purpose of offering short-term accommodation at very economical pricing. Further, travelers get to meet other guests and may build a network of talented individuals.

Special features

  • Designed for community living, with shared areas like kitchens, living rooms, and workspaces
  • Private bedrooms combined with the comfort of a furnished apartment and the social aspects of a shared living environment
  • Cost-effective option for solo business travelers or those seeking a collaborative atmosphere.

What to consider when choosing corporate travel accommodation?

  • One should select the accommodation that is conveniently located near the event or meeting venue to save time and cost of travel.
  • While selecting the accommodation you should ensure high speed Wi-Fi access, business facilities, fitness center, and breakfast option is provided by the hotel.
  • To save money, look for affordable options with heavy discounts and negotiated prices else always go with 5 or 4 star hotels.
  • You should scout for safe location while selecting the hotel for your employees.
  • The hotel should provide easy cancellation and check in options.

Evolution of business travel accommodation

  • Technology Integration: The rise of online booking platforms and mobile apps has made it easier for travelers to research, book, and manage their accommodations.
  • Personalization: Accommodation providers are increasingly offering personalized experiences as per the preferences and priorities of business travelers.
  • Sustainability: There is growing awareness and demand for sustainable travel practices, leading to the emergence of eco-friendly accommodation options to reduce environmental impact.

What do business travel managers look for when booking accommodation for business travel?

Business travel managers can choose to book accommodation themselves or let employees choose their options. In both cases, there are certain criteria that they look for. They are the convenience of the traveler, amenities available like food or room service, vicinity to the city center and the business hub of the city, uninterrupted connectivity, and peaceful atmosphere so that business can also be conducted while in the comfort of the accommodation. Employees may also look for a stay that is very comfortable and luxurious.

What type of accommodation will fulfill travelers looking for peace, quiet, and more privacy?

For more reclusive stays away from city centers, Farmhouses or corporate housing are the prime choice, providing more privacy than hotels or serviced apartments while having great connectivity and similar amenities.

What are some non-conventional accommodation choices?

Boutique hotels provide a unique experience with every stay and co-living spaces provide a tidy yet budget option to travelers and employees traveling with constraints.
